Let's have a chat
+27 82 610 2112
Send us an email
levi@leviticus.co.za
Home
About
Projects
Expertise
Contact
Home
About
Projects
Expertise
Contact
Project Enquiry
Let’s chat
+27 82 610 2112
Location
Cape Town, South Africa
Send an email
levi@leviticus.co.za
Social
© 2025
All Rights Reserved | Leviticus Creative Pty ltd
Terms & Privacy
Share by: